Pakistan Baitul Mal Launches Annual Scholarship

Pakistan Baitul Mal has recently announced the launch of a new annual scholarship program for students enrolled in the Department of Sociology at the University of Peshawar. Under a newly signed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) between the two institutions, Pakistan Baitul Mal will provide 60 scholarships every year to financially deserving and academically meritorious students. This initiative is designed to support talented students who may otherwise face challenges in pursuing higher education due to economic constraints.

The total annual allocation for the scholarship program is approximately Rs. 3.6 million. The program aims to bridge the gap between talent and opportunity by offering financial assistance that allows students to focus on their studies without worrying about tuition fees or other educational expenses. The launch of this program reflects Pakistan Baitul Mal’s ongoing commitment to promoting education and empowering students from diverse socio-economic backgrounds.

Roles of Focal Persons and Committee

Two key officials have been appointed to supervise the scholarship program:

  • Dr. Syed Owas, Chairman of the Department of Sociology, will manage academic verification and ensure applicants meet the department’s criteria.
  • Sheraz, Director Finance of Pakistan Baitul Mal, will oversee fund allocation, ensuring transparent and timely disbursement.

In addition to the focal persons, the Vice Chancellor has proposed the creation of a special committee that will include representatives from the Department of Sociology, Pakistan Baitul Mal, and the university administration. This committee will:

  • Develop and implement clear terms of reference for scholarship management
  • Review applications in a merit- and need-based framework
  • Monitor disbursement and use of scholarship funds
  • Provide guidance for any disputes or discrepancies in the selection process

By establishing a structured management system, the scholarship program ensures fairness and transparency while fostering strong collaboration between the university and Pakistan Baitul Mal.

Step-by-Step Application Process

The scholarship application process has been designed to be straightforward, ensuring that students can easily submit their applications and provide all necessary documentation.

  • Gather Required Documents: Students must prepare a detailed curriculum vitae (CV), attested copies of their educational certificates and degree completion letter, an attested CNIC copy, and two recent passport-size photographs. Attestation must be done by a gazetted officer, university official, or authorized authority. Incomplete documents may result in disqualification.
  • Submit Application: Students can submit their applications in person at the Department of Sociology or via email as directed by the university. Applications should be submitted before the designated deadline to ensure consideration.
  • Review and Selection: The focal persons and committee will review all applications based on financial need and academic merit. Only shortlisted candidates will be contacted for further verification.
  • Disbursement of Scholarship: Selected students will receive their scholarship funds according to the schedule defined by Pakistan Baitul Mal, ensuring timely support for their academic needs.

This step-by-step process ensures that the scholarship program remains fair, accessible, and efficient, benefiting deserving students while maintaining accountability.
